MDA Space to Acquire Collecte Localisation Satellites

MDA Space to Acquire Collecte Localisation Satellites

MDA Space, a trusted mission partner to the rapidly expanding global space industry, announced that it has entered into a firm and irrevocable offer to acquire a majority interest in CLS (the “Transaction”), a global leading provider of AI-driven Earth observation value-added services and satellite IoT solutions. With more than 14,000 customers in approximately 150 countries, CLS is expected to generate approximately €286 million (C$465 million) in revenue in 2026.

Pursuant to the Transaction, at completion, MDA Space would acquire an approximately 70% interest in CLS from the shareholders of CLS’s parent company, for approximately €567 million (C$920 million) in cash (subject to adjustments). The Centre national d'études spatiales (“CNES”), the French space agency, would retain an approximately 30% interest in CLS.

Existing and next generation MDA Space investments in Earth and space observation assets, ground stations and associated data and analytics seamlessly complement core monitoring and forecasting applications pioneered by CLS.

“Our goal is for MDA Space to provide global government and commercial customers with the broadest and richest offering of multi-sensor Earth and space observation data, products, and services on the market,” said Mike Greenley, Chief Executive Officer of MDA Space. “Bringing together MDA Space and CLS is a unique opportunity to create a growing, profitable, highly competitive and vertically integrated geospatial services business with industry leading capabilities and go-to-market channels to address demand globally and accelerate growth for both businesses. Equally important, it preserves critical sovereign capabilities and capacity in France and Canada.”

Founded in 1986 as a subsidiary of the CNES, CLS has continuously invested in innovative space-based solutions to monitor and protect the planet. With headquarters in Toulouse, and 40 sites worldwide, CLS employs approximately 1,200 people dedicated to sustainable resource management.

“For more than 40 years, CLS has been harnessing space technologies, data and innovation to help better understand our planet and support its sustainable management. Joining forces with MDA Space represents a unique opportunity to accelerate our development, expand the global reach of our solutions and strengthen our innovation capabilities” said Stéphanie Limouzin, Chief Executive Officer of CLS. “We are confident that this new chapter will create value for our customers, employees and partners, while preserving what makes CLS unique: its mission-driven culture, deep expertise and longstanding commitment to delivering solutions that support a more sustainable and resilient world.”

Following the closing of the acquisition of CLS and the previously announced acquisition of Blue Canyon Technologies, MDA Space expects to be within its target range of 1.5x – 2.5x net debt to Adjusted EBITDA.
